In the rapidly evolving world of technology, one concept has been gaining immense popularity and changing the way businesses operate – cloud computing. The magical power of cloud computing is revolutionizing industries across the globe, offering unprecedented opportunities for growth, efficiency, and innovation.
By harnessing the power of remote servers, businesses are no longer limited by physical infrastructure, allowing them to scale their operations, store and access data securely, and collaborate effortlessly.
This transformative technology eliminates the need for expensive hardware upgrades and maintenance, enabling businesses to streamline their operations and focus on their core competencies. With its ability to deliver flexible, scalable, and cost-effective solutions, cloud computing has become an indispensable tool for businesses of all sizes and industries.
In this article, we will delve into the wonders of cloud computing, exploring its benefits, challenges, and the impact it has on businesses in today’s digital age. Get ready to unlock the secrets of this magical technology and witness its transformative power firsthand.
Advantages of Cloud Computing for Businesses
Cloud computing offers a multitude of advantages for businesses, regardless of their size or industry. One of the key benefits is cost savings. With cloud computing, businesses no longer need to invest in expensive hardware and software licenses. Instead, they can pay for the services they use on a subscription basis, allowing them to scale their resources up or down as needed. This pay-as-you-go model not only reduces upfront costs but also eliminates the need for ongoing maintenance and upgrades. Furthermore, cloud computing providers typically offer competitive pricing, making it a cost-effective solution for businesses.
Another advantage of cloud computing is its flexibility and scalability. Traditional IT infrastructure requires businesses to estimate their resource needs in advance and invest in hardware and software accordingly. This often leads to overprovisioning or underutilization of resources, resulting in wasted costs. With cloud computing, businesses can dynamically adjust their resource allocation based on their current needs. Whether it’s increasing server capacity during peak periods or scaling down during slower times, cloud computing allows businesses to optimize their resource utilization, ensuring maximum efficiency and cost savings.
In addition to cost savings and flexibility, cloud computing also offers improved collaboration and productivity. With cloud-based applications and services, teams can work together on documents in real-time, regardless of their physical location. This enables seamless collaboration, enhances communication, and eliminates version control issues. Furthermore, cloud-based project management tools and communication platforms facilitate efficient teamwork, allowing teams to stay connected and organized. By streamlining collaboration and enhancing productivity, cloud computing empowers businesses to work smarter and achieve better results.
Cloud Computing Statistics and Trends
The rapid growth of cloud computing is evident from the latest statistics and trends in the industry. According to a report by Gartner, the worldwide public cloud services market is projected to grow by 18.4% in 2021, reaching a total value of $304.9 billion. This indicates the increasing adoption of cloud computing by businesses across various sectors. Furthermore, a survey conducted by Flexera revealed that 94% of organizations are already using cloud services in some capacity, highlighting the widespread adoption of this technology.
One of the key trends in cloud computing is the rise of hybrid cloud models. A hybrid cloud combines the benefits of both public and private clouds, allowing businesses to leverage the advantages of each. This model is particularly beneficial for organizations with sensitive data or regulatory compliance requirements. By utilizing a hybrid cloud approach, businesses can keep their critical data on-premises or in a private cloud, while leveraging the scalability and cost-effectiveness of public cloud services for non-sensitive workloads. This hybrid approach offers the best of both worlds, providing businesses with greater flexibility and control over their data and applications.
Another emerging trend in cloud computing is the increasing focus on edge computing. Edge computing brings the power of cloud computing closer to the data source, reducing latency and enabling real-time processing. This is especially important for applications that require low latency, such as IoT devices and autonomous vehicles. By decentralizing processing power and moving it closer to the edge of the network, businesses can achieve faster response times and improved performance. Edge computing is expected to play a significant role in the future of cloud computing, enabling new and innovative applications that require real-time data processing.
Different Types of Cloud Computing Models – Public, Private, and Hybrid
Cloud computing offers various deployment models, each catering to different business needs and requirements. The three primary types of cloud computing models are public, private, and hybrid clouds.
A public cloud is a cloud infrastructure that is owned and operated by a third-party cloud service provider. It is available to the general public and can be accessed through the internet. Public clouds offer a high level of scalability, as resources can be easily provisioned and deprovisioned based on demand. They also provide cost savings, as businesses only pay for the services they use. However, public clouds may not be suitable for organizations with sensitive data or strict compliance requirements, as the data is stored and processed on shared infrastructure.
Private clouds, on the other hand, are dedicated cloud infrastructures that are owned and operated by a single organization. They can be hosted on-premises or in a data center and offer greater control and security compared to public clouds. Private clouds are ideal for businesses that handle sensitive data or have strict compliance requirements, as they provide a higher level of data privacy and control. However, private clouds require significant upfront investment and ongoing maintenance, making them more suitable for large enterprises with substantial IT resources.
Hybrid clouds combine the benefits of both public and private clouds, allowing businesses to leverage the advantages of each. With a hybrid cloud model, organizations can keep their critical data and applications in a private cloud or on-premises infrastructure, while utilizing public cloud services for non-sensitive workloads. This hybrid approach offers greater flexibility, scalability, and cost-effectiveness, making it an attractive option for businesses that require both security and agility. Hybrid clouds also enable seamless data migration between public and private environments, allowing businesses to adapt to changing needs and requirements.
How Cloud Computing is Transforming Businesses
Cloud computing has a transformative impact on businesses, enabling them to innovate, scale, and adapt to changing market conditions. One of the key ways cloud computing is transforming businesses is by enabling digital transformation. With cloud-based infrastructure and services, businesses can replace legacy systems and processes with modern, agile solutions. This allows them to streamline their operations, improve efficiency, and enhance customer experiences. Cloud computing provides businesses with the technology foundation they need to embrace digital transformation and stay ahead in today’s fast-paced digital age.
Another area where cloud computing is making a significant impact is in data analytics and business intelligence. With the ability to store and process large volumes of data, businesses can gain valuable insights and make data-driven decisions. Cloud-based analytics platforms offer powerful tools and capabilities, such as machine learning and predictive analytics, that enable businesses to uncover hidden patterns, identify trends, and optimize their operations. By harnessing the power of cloud computing for data analytics, businesses can gain a competitive edge and drive growth.
Furthermore, cloud computing is revolutionizing the way businesses collaborate and communicate. With cloud-based collaboration tools and communication platforms, teams can work together seamlessly, regardless of their location. This enables remote work, flexible schedules, and global collaborations, breaking down geographical barriers and fostering innovation. Cloud computing also provides businesses with real-time access to data and applications, allowing employees to make informed decisions and respond quickly to market changes. By enhancing collaboration and communication, cloud computing empowers businesses to work smarter, improve productivity, and deliver better results.
Cloud Computing Security and Data Protection
While cloud computing offers numerous benefits, security and data protection remain key concerns for businesses. Entrusting sensitive data and applications to a third-party cloud service provider requires robust security measures and protocols. Cloud computing providers invest heavily in security technologies and practices to ensure the protection of their customers’ data.
One of the primary security features of cloud computing is data encryption. Cloud service providers encrypt data both during transit and at rest, ensuring that it remains secure throughout its lifecycle. Encryption protects data from unauthorized access, making it virtually impossible for hackers to intercept or decipher sensitive information. Additionally, cloud providers implement strict access controls and authentication mechanisms to ensure that only authorized individuals can access the data.
Another important aspect of cloud computing security is data backup and disaster recovery. Cloud service providers employ redundant infrastructure and data replication techniques to ensure the availability and integrity of their customers’ data. In the event of a hardware failure or natural disaster, the data can be quickly restored from backups, minimizing downtime and data loss. Regular backups and disaster recovery plans are essential components of cloud computing security, providing businesses with peace of mind and protection against unforeseen events.
To further enhance security, businesses should also implement their own security measures and best practices. This includes strong password policies, multi-factor authentication, regular security audits, and employee training on cybersecurity awareness. By adopting a holistic approach to security, businesses can mitigate risks and ensure the integrity of their data in the cloud.
Choosing the Right Cloud Computing Provider
Selecting the right cloud computing provider is crucial for businesses to maximize the benefits of cloud computing. There are numerous cloud service providers in the market, each offering different features, pricing, and support options. When choosing a cloud computing provider, businesses should consider several factors.
First and foremost, businesses should assess their specific needs and requirements. This includes evaluating the types of services and applications they plan to migrate to the cloud, as well as their security and compliance requirements. Different cloud providers specialize in different areas, so businesses should choose a provider that aligns with their specific needs.
Another important factor to consider is the reliability and performance of the cloud provider’s infrastructure. This includes evaluating the provider’s uptime guarantees, service level agreements, and data center locations. Businesses should ensure that the provider’s infrastructure is robust and can handle their workload requirements without performance issues or downtime.
Pricing is also a key consideration when choosing a cloud computing provider. Businesses should carefully review the provider’s pricing structure, including any additional costs for data transfer, storage, or support. It’s important to understand the pricing model and ensure that it aligns with the business’s budget and scalability requirements.
Finally, businesses should assess the provider’s reputation and customer support capabilities. Reading customer reviews and testimonials can provide insights into the provider’s reliability, responsiveness, and overall customer satisfaction. Additionally, businesses should evaluate the provider’s support options, including technical support availability, response times, and escalation processes.
By thoroughly evaluating these factors, businesses can choose a cloud computing provider that meets their specific needs and ensures a smooth transition to the cloud.
Implementing Cloud Computing in Your Business
Implementing cloud computing in a business requires careful planning and execution. The following steps can help businesses successfully adopt cloud computing:
1. **Assess current IT infrastructure:** Before migrating to the cloud, businesses should evaluate their existing IT infrastructure, including hardware, software, and data storage capabilities. This assessment will help identify the areas that can be migrated to the cloud and the potential challenges that may arise.
2. **Define migration strategy:** Businesses should develop a comprehensive migration strategy that outlines the timeline, resources, and steps involved in the migration process. This strategy should consider factors such as data security, application compatibility, and employee training needs.
3. **Select cloud computing model:** Based on the business’s needs and requirements, the appropriate cloud computing model should be selected. Whether it’s a public, private, or hybrid cloud, businesses should choose the model that aligns with their specific goals and objectives.
4. **Choose cloud computing provider:** After selecting the cloud computing model, businesses should choose a reliable and reputable cloud computing provider. The provider should offer the necessary services and support to meet the business’s requirements.
5. **Migrate data and applications:** Once the cloud provider is selected, businesses can start migrating their data and applications to the cloud. This process should be carefully planned and executed to minimize disruption and ensure data integrity.
6. **Train employees:** It’s crucial to provide employees with the necessary training and support to adapt to the cloud environment. This includes educating them on cloud computing concepts, security best practices, and how to use cloud-based applications.
7. **Monitor and optimize:** After the migration is complete, businesses should continuously monitor and optimize their cloud infrastructure. This includes monitoring performance, security, and cost optimization to ensure maximum efficiency and ROI.
By following these steps, businesses can successfully implement cloud computing and unlock its full potential for growth and innovation.
Cloud Computing Case Studies and Success Stories
Numerous businesses have already embraced cloud computing and reaped the rewards. Let’s explore a few real-world case studies and success stories that demonstrate the transformative power of cloud computing:
### Case Study 1: Netflix
Netflix, the world’s leading streaming entertainment service, is a prime example of how cloud computing can revolutionize an industry. By migrating its infrastructure to the cloud, Netflix was able to scale its operations globally and deliver seamless streaming experiences to millions of viewers. The cloud-based infrastructure allows Netflix to handle massive amounts of data and deliver personalized recommendations to its users. Additionally, the cloud enables Netflix to optimize its content delivery, reducing buffering and improving video quality. Through cloud computing, Netflix has transformed the way we consume entertainment and set new standards for the industry.
### Case Study 2: Airbnb
Airbnb, the popular online marketplace for vacation rentals, relies heavily on cloud computing to power its platform. By leveraging the scalability and flexibility of the cloud, Airbnb is able to accommodate millions of listings and handle high volumes of traffic. The cloud infrastructure allows hosts to easily manage their listings, while guests can search, book, and communicate seamlessly. Furthermore, the cloud enables Airbnb to implement sophisticated algorithms and machine learning models to improve search results and provide personalized recommendations. Cloud computing has been instrumental in Airbnb’s rapid growth and success, enabling it to disrupt the hospitality industry and create new opportunities for hosts and guests worldwide.
### Case Study 3: Slack
Slack, the widely-used team collaboration platform, owes its success to cloud computing. By utilizing the cloud, Slack provides real-time messaging, file sharing, and collaboration features to teams around the world. The cloud infrastructure allows Slack to handle millions of simultaneous users and ensure reliable, secure communication. Additionally, the cloud enables Slack to integrate with numerous other applications and services, enhancing productivity and streamlining workflows. Cloud computing has transformed the way teams communicate and collaborate, making Slack an indispensable tool for businesses of all sizes.
These case studies highlight the immense potential of cloud computing to transform industries and drive innovation. By embracing cloud computing, businesses can unlock new possibilities and achieve unprecedented growth and success.
Conclusion: The Future of Cloud Computing
Cloud computing has already made a significant impact on businesses, enabling them to scale, innovate, and adapt to the ever-changing digital landscape.